Output 668156657223b90267cd51d9a71613c39c1edf35b586c1d372605bf8f00a41a0:1093

value
81804
script pubkey
OP_0 OP_PUSHBYTES_20 9467ec8034d227d21842c4a78fa22ed8c9cb2b7f
address
bc1qj3n7eqp56gnayxzzcjnclg3wmryuk2mlv8ff55
transaction
668156657223b90267cd51d9a71613c39c1edf35b586c1d372605bf8f00a41a0
confirmations
171646
spent
true